Phase locked loops
Abstract
The theory and applications of phase locked loops (PLLs) are described. Particular consideration is given to a qualitative-numerical method for the analysis of three-dimensional nonlinear PLLs; the analysis of continuous PLLs using two-dimensional comparison systems; the use of cumulant analysis to analyze PLLs; PLLs using complex PSK signals; the stability analysis of PLLs with complex signals; and models of discrete PLLs. Also considered are Markov models of digital PLLs; a quasi-continuous method for the analysis of digital PLLs; optimal PLLs; the application of digital PLLs for signal processing on a noise background; and discriminators in PLLs for the processing of complex signals.
